The Page Builder service allows users to create and customize their own personal website to showcase their digital assets on the LUKSO blockchain. The website created with the Page Builder is known as a Universal Profile Page (UPN), which is an NFT minted on the LUKSO blockchain. Each UPN has a unique domain within the universal.page domain, or a unique page name.
A limited number of UPNs are available for free, but users can reserve additional UPNs by purchasing them with LYX, the native cryptocurrency of the LUKSO blockchain. The price of a UPN may change without notice. By using the Page Builder to create a unique UPN, users can turn their Universal Profile into a personalized website that showcases their digital assets on the LUKSO blockchain.
The UniversalPage platform allows users to enable payments on their personal website, allowing them to receive LYX directly from other users. To make a payment, a user can navigate to the profile page of the recipient and initiate a transfer of LYX from their own profile. The payment can be accompanied by a message indicating the purpose of the payment.
The payments on the UniversalPage platform are facilitated by a smart contract, which enables custom experiences such as attaching a message to the payment. The smart contract also enables payments to be made without any fees, as the transfers are recorded directly on the LUKSO blockchain. All transfers made through the payments contract are available for anyone to access, providing transparency and security for the transactions.
UniversalPage uses LUKSO Standard Proposals (LSPs) to define the standards for digital assets on the platform. The relevant LSPs for the Marketplace are LSP7 - digital asset, and LSP8 - identifiable digital asset. These LSPs specify the requirements for listing and trading NFTs on the UniversalPage platform.
The UniversalPage platform is built on the LUKSO blockchain, which is a decentralized platform for creating and trading digital assets. LYX is the native currency of the LUKSO blockchain, and it is used for all transactions on the UniversalPage platform, including purchasing UPNs, making payments, and trading NFTs on the Marketplace.
The Marketplace is a set of smart contracts that enable the listing of NFTs for sale, coordinating offers made by users, and facilitating the sale and transfer of sold NFTs. The Marketplace takes a 3.5% fee on each sale of an NFT.
The Marketplace contract does not acquire users' NFTs when they are listed for sale. Instead, the smart contract requests authorization to transfer the NFTs when they are sold. The Marketplace integrates with the Listings and Offers services to coordinate requirements such as the price of the NFT and any other conditions for making a sale. This allows users to easily trade NFTs on the LUKSO blockchain using the UniversalPage platform.
Listings are smart contracts that are used to describe and track the availability of LSP7 and LSP8 digital assets for sale by Universal Profiles on the UniversalPage platform. The Listings contracts do not transfer or collect payments from users; instead, they are used to provide information about the NFTs that are available for sale.
Users have full control over their listings, and can create, update, and cancel any of their listings at any time. The Listings contracts provide an easy way for users to make their NFTs available for sale on the Marketplace, and provide potential buyers with information about the NFTs that are available.
Offers are smart contracts that are used to describe and track buy inquiries made by Universal Profiles on listings of NFTs available for sale on the UniversalPage platform. Users can make only one offer per listing, but they can increase their offer (also known as "topping off") or cancel it at any time.
To make an offer, a user must pay an upfront fee to the offers escrow. A sale of an NFT only takes place if the seller accepts the offer. If the seller does not accept the offer, the user can cancel their offer at any time and their funds will be returned from the offers escrow.
The Offers contracts provide a way for buyers to express interest in purchasing an NFT, and for sellers to review and respond to offers made on their listings. This helps to facilitate the sale of NFTs on the Marketplace.
The Marketplace on the UniversalPage platform takes into account royalties that may be charged on each sale of an NFT. Royalties are set up by the owner or creator of the NFT and can be a percentage of the sale price. The maximum amount of royalties that can be charged on a sale is 15%.
When an NFT is listed for sale on the Marketplace, the royalties are clearly stated on the frontend website, along with the total listing price and any fees that may be deducted from the sale price. This allows potential buyers to see the full cost of the NFT, including any royalties that may be charged, before making an offer to purchase the NFT.
Overall, the inclusion of royalties in the Marketplace helps to support the creators and owners of NFTs by allowing them to earn a portion of the proceeds from each sale of their NFTs.
The UniversalPage platform charges a 3.5% fee on each sale of an NFT on the Marketplace. This fee is non-refundable and will be deducted from the sale price of the NFT.
